Severe Weather Database

• These kind of databases are generally too linked to each met. Service.

• The Group agreed not to take specific action on this topic, but decided to inform the EUMETCAL community that the group may help on organizing locally databases on High Impact Weather, if requested.

Tasks for next 12 months 4 – Template for Simulator of warning cases (and also non-

warning!)

Why? Because each Met. Service has its own way of dealing with warnings

Advantage? Each Met. Service can include its own material

How? Cooperation with Techical solutions WG aiming to a joint workshop on Flash for trainers (late 2010?)
